Very excited that our work describing hu.MAP3.0 is published in @molsystbiol.org. Here we use machine learning to integrate >25k mass spectrometry experiments to place ~70% of human proteins into 15k protein complexes.

www.embopress.org/doi/full/10....
hu.MAP3.0: atlas of human protein complexes by integration of >25,000 proteomic experiments | Molecular Systems Biology
imageimagehu.MAP3.0 integrates mass spectrometry experiments to identify human protein complexes. Using this resource, this study characterizes covariation of complexes, identifies mutually exclusive ...
